pub struct ALC_SOFT_loopback {
pub ALC_BYTE_SOFT: ExtResult<ALCenum>,
pub ALC_UNSIGNED_BYTE_SOFT: ExtResult<ALCenum>,
pub ALC_SHORT_SOFT: ExtResult<ALCenum>,
pub ALC_UNSIGNED_SHORT_SOFT: ExtResult<ALCenum>,
pub ALC_INT_SOFT: ExtResult<ALCenum>,
pub ALC_UNSIGNED_INT_SOFT: ExtResult<ALCenum>,
pub ALC_FLOAT_SOFT: ExtResult<ALCenum>,
pub ALC_MONO_SOFT: ExtResult<ALCenum>,
pub ALC_STEREO_SOFT: ExtResult<ALCenum>,
pub ALC_QUAD_SOFT: ExtResult<ALCenum>,
pub ALC_5POINT1_SOFT: ExtResult<ALCenum>,
pub ALC_6POINT1_SOFT: ExtResult<ALCenum>,
pub ALC_7POINT1_SOFT: ExtResult<ALCenum>,
pub ALC_FORMAT_CHANNELS_SOFT: ExtResult<ALCenum>,
pub ALC_FORMAT_TYPE_SOFT: ExtResult<ALCenum>,
pub alcLoopbackOpenDeviceSOFT: ExtResult<unsafe extern "C" fn(_: *const ALCchar) -> *mut ALCdevice>,
pub alcIsRenderFormatSupportedSOFT: ExtResult<unsafe extern "C" fn(_: *mut ALCdevice, _: ALCsizei, _: ALCenum, _: ALCenum) -> ALCboolean>,
pub alcRenderSamplesSOFT: ExtResult<unsafe extern "C" fn(_: *mut ALCdevice, _: *mut ALvoid, _: ALCsizei)>,
}
Fields
ALC_BYTE_SOFT: ExtResult<ALCenum>
ALC_UNSIGNED_BYTE_SOFT: ExtResult<ALCenum>
ALC_SHORT_SOFT: ExtResult<ALCenum>
ALC_UNSIGNED_SHORT_SOFT: ExtResult<ALCenum>
ALC_INT_SOFT: ExtResult<ALCenum>
ALC_UNSIGNED_INT_SOFT: ExtResult<ALCenum>
ALC_FLOAT_SOFT: ExtResult<ALCenum>
ALC_MONO_SOFT: ExtResult<ALCenum>
ALC_STEREO_SOFT: ExtResult<ALCenum>
ALC_QUAD_SOFT: ExtResult<ALCenum>
ALC_5POINT1_SOFT: ExtResult<ALCenum>
ALC_6POINT1_SOFT: ExtResult<ALCenum>
ALC_7POINT1_SOFT: ExtResult<ALCenum>
ALC_FORMAT_CHANNELS_SOFT: ExtResult<ALCenum>
ALC_FORMAT_TYPE_SOFT: ExtResult<ALCenum>
alcLoopbackOpenDeviceSOFT: ExtResult<unsafe extern "C" fn(_: *const ALCchar) -> *mut ALCdevice>
alcIsRenderFormatSupportedSOFT: ExtResult<unsafe extern "C" fn(_: *mut ALCdevice, _: ALCsizei, _: ALCenum, _: ALCenum) -> ALCboolean>
alcRenderSamplesSOFT: ExtResult<unsafe extern "C" fn(_: *mut ALCdevice, _: *mut ALvoid, _: ALCsizei)>
Methods
Trait Implementations
Formats the value using the given formatter.